Stomach meaning


Stomach is a versatile word that can be used in various contexts to describe both a physical organ and a metaphorical concept. In this article, we will explore different tips on how to use the word "stomach" or the phrase "in the stomach" effectively in sentences.


1. Physical Organ: The word "stomach" primarily refers to the organ located in the upper abdomen that plays a crucial role in digestion. Here are some tips on how to use it in sentences: - Medical Context: "The doctor diagnosed him with a stomach ulcer." - Descriptive Context: "She felt a sharp pain in her stomach after eating spicy food." - Comparative Context: "His appetite is like a bottomless pit; he has the stomach of a champion eater."


2. Metaphorical Concept: Apart from its anatomical meaning, "stomach" can also be used metaphorically to describe emotions, tolerance, or endurance. Here are some tips on how to use the phrase "in the stomach" in sentences: - Nervousness or Anxiety: "She had butterflies in her stomach before her big presentation." - Disgust or Revulsion: "The sight of the rotten food turned his stomach." - Tolerance or Acceptance: "He couldn't stomach the idea of leaving his friends behind." - Emotional Resilience: "Despite the hardships, she had the strength to keep going; she had a strong stomach for adversity."


3. Idiomatic Expressions: The word "stomach" is also used in various idiomatic expressions. Here are some tips on how to use these phrases effectively: - Turn someone's stomach: "The graphic images in the horror movie turned her stomach." - Have a strong stomach: "Being a doctor requires having a strong stomach to handle gruesome injuries." - Butterflies in the stomach: "He always gets butterflies in his stomach before a job interview."


4. Collocations: Collocations are words that are commonly used together with a specific term. Here are some tips on how to use "stomach" in collocations: - Upset stomach: "She had an upset stomach after eating the spoiled food." - Empty stomach: "It's not advisable to take medication on an empty stomach." - Growling stomach: "His growling stomach reminded him that it was time for lunch." Remember, when using the word "stomach" or the phrase "in the stomach" in sentences, it is essential to consider the context and choose the appropriate meaning. Whether you are referring to the physical organ, metaphorical concept, idiomatic expressions, or collocations, using these tips will help you effectively incorporate the word "stomach" into your writing or conversation.
